For some reason, my Fitbit Versa decided to stop working on me today, despite being fully charged. The screen is just completely blank. It very occasionally vibrates for less than a second but that's the only sign of life. I've tried doing a reset (pressing the back and bottom buttons) but have had no luck with that.
I'm not sure if this is related but a few days the battery completely died and then the next day after I'd fully charged it, it randomly decided to wipe my step count and start from 0 in the middle of the day. Very weird.
Any advice would be much appreciated. I can't face having to pay out for a new one...I haven't even had this one that long!
UPDATE: It actually appears to be measuring my heart rate...I can see the little green light! And it also seems to be tracking my steps from what I can see on the app.
